Coaching Accomplishments |
Has mentored one All-American and six all-conference selections, including Marquis Spruill and Cameron Lynch at Syracuse. Spruill was selected in the fifth round of the 2014 NFL Draft by the Atlanta Falcons. |
The 2014 Orange defense held nine of its 12 opponents to less than its season average for total offense and was one of four FBS teams to surrender fewer than 10 rushing touchdowns (9). Alabama (5), TCU (9) and Ole Miss (9) were the others. |
In 2014, the SU defense was responsible for four touchdowns (2 INT returns, 2 fumble returns), including two in the team’s win at Wake Forest. |
In 2013, the Syracuse defense finished ranked nationally in multiple categories, including third-down defense (15th), rush defense (24th), sacks (18th), and tackles for loss (18th). |
In 2012, the Bowling Green defense ranked ranked in the top nationally in pass defense (7th), scoring defense (9th), and third-down defense (6th). |
In 2012, the Bowling Green defense led the Mid-American Conference (MAC) in nine statistical categories. |
2012 FootballScoop.com Linebackers Coach of the Year finalist. |
In 2009, the UCLA defense ranked third in the Pac-10. |
In 2006, the UCLA defense ranked ninth nationally in rush defense, sixth in sacks, and fifth in tackles for loss. |
Playing Accomplishments |
Member of the 2001 Birmingham-Southern College baseball team that won the NAIA World Series. |
Baseball letterwinner at Belmont University (2002). |
Three-year football letterwinner at Vanderbilt (2002-04). |
All-SEC Academic Team selection in 2003 and 2004. |
Finalist for the 2005 John Wooden Cup. |
2005 H. Boyd McWhorter Scholar-Athlete Award recipient. |
